Pydroid 3 - IDE for Python 3

Pydroid 3 - IDE for Python 3
Pydroid 3 - IDE for Python 3
Developer: Lider Soft KZ
Category: Education
13.1M installs
73.1K ratings
+72.9K weekly installs
trend steady
+301.7K monthly installs
trend steady
Pydroid 3 - IDE for Python 3 icon

ASO Keyword Dashboard

Tracking 108 keywords for Pydroid 3 - IDE for Python 3 in Google Play

Developer: Lider Soft KZ Category: education Rating: 4.46

Pydroid 3 - IDE for Python 3 tracks 108 keywords (9 keywords rank; 99 need traction). Key metrics: 0% top-10 coverage, opportunity 69.4, difficulty 52.0, best rank 44.

Learn Python 3 with the most powerful Python 3 interpreter & IDE on Google Play

Tracked keywords

108

9  ranked •  99  not ranking yet

Top 10 coverage

0%

Best rank 44 • Latest leader —

Avg opportunity

69.4

Top keyword: analysis

Avg difficulty

52.0

Lower scores indicate easier wins

Opportunity leaders

  • analysis

    Opportunity: 73.0 • Difficulty: 44.9 • Rank —

    Competitors: 737

    68.1
  • integrated

    Opportunity: 72.0 • Difficulty: 48.7 • Rank 45

    Competitors: 1,066

    70.1
  • import

    Opportunity: 72.0 • Difficulty: 52.9 • Rank 53

    Competitors: 844

    64.8
  • source

    Opportunity: 72.0 • Difficulty: 52.0 • Rank 190

    Competitors: 959

    69.3
  • navigation

    Opportunity: 72.0 • Difficulty: 58.5 • Rank —

    Competitors: 1,141

    70.1

Unranked opportunities

  • analysis

    Opportunity: 73.0 • Difficulty: 44.9 • Competitors: 737

  • navigation

    Opportunity: 72.0 • Difficulty: 58.5 • Competitors: 1,141

  • library

    Opportunity: 72.0 • Difficulty: 64.8 • Competitors: 1,491

  • internal

    Opportunity: 72.0 • Difficulty: 48.2 • Competitors: 571

  • auto

    Opportunity: 72.0 • Difficulty: 57.5 • Competitors: 2,222

High competition keywords

  • new

    Total apps: 193,474 • Major competitors: 25,823

    Latest rank: — • Difficulty: 65.7

  • free

    Total apps: 173,844 • Major competitors: 23,343

    Latest rank: — • Difficulty: 64.4

  • time

    Total apps: 170,577 • Major competitors: 19,592

    Latest rank: — • Difficulty: 64.6

  • easy

    Total apps: 161,730 • Major competitors: 17,537

    Latest rank: — • Difficulty: 61.7

  • like

    Total apps: 150,415 • Major competitors: 21,531

    Latest rank: — • Difficulty: 68.5

All tracked keywords

Includes opportunity, difficulty, rankings and competitor benchmarks

Major Competitors
program711004773

19,009 competing apps

Median installs: 26,294

Avg rating: 2.7

4444

1,273

major competitor apps

part691006177

31,519 competing apps

Median installs: 30,635

Avg rating: 2.8

4945

3,488

major competitor apps

integrated721004970

12,624 competing apps

Median installs: 24,158

Avg rating: 2.7

4545

1,066

major competitor apps

import721005365

6,186 competing apps

Median installs: 51,764

Avg rating: 3.2

5353

844

major competitor apps

user friendly711003962

4,076 competing apps

Median installs: 34,110

Avg rating: 2.4

7272

284

major competitor apps

interface681005279

41,743 competing apps

Median installs: 24,264

Avg rating: 2.6

8380

3,368

major competitor apps

developed701004874

21,997 competing apps

Median installs: 22,751

Avg rating: 2.5

8585

1,467

major competitor apps

using651006486

114,758 competing apps

Median installs: 37,480

Avg rating: 2.8

117111

13,323

major competitor apps

source721005269

11,396 competing apps

Median installs: 27,566

Avg rating: 2.9

190190

959

major competitor apps

free641006490

173,844 competing apps

Median installs: 46,597

Avg rating: 3.1

23,343

major competitor apps

play651006786

113,236 competing apps

Median installs: 62,750

Avg rating: 3.2

19,366

major competitor apps

new641006690

193,474 competing apps

Median installs: 42,470

Avg rating: 3.0

25,823

major competitor apps

offline681006081

54,787 competing apps

Median installs: 36,532

Avg rating: 2.9

6,486

major competitor apps

navigation721005870

12,601 competing apps

Median installs: 27,732

Avg rating: 2.7

1,141

major competitor apps

share661006586

102,576 competing apps

Median installs: 35,820

Avg rating: 2.9

11,283

major competitor apps

mode691006578

35,564 competing apps

Median installs: 53,723

Avg rating: 3.1

5,505

major competitor apps

library721006571

13,762 competing apps

Median installs: 29,536

Avg rating: 2.9

1,491

major competitor apps

version691006177

30,986 competing apps

Median installs: 38,306

Avg rating: 3.1

3,300

major competitor apps

internal721004865

6,261 competing apps

Median installs: 25,932

Avg rating: 2.7

571

major competitor apps

easy641006289

161,730 competing apps

Median installs: 33,636

Avg rating: 2.8

17,537

major competitor apps

support671006083

68,575 competing apps

Median installs: 34,249

Avg rating: 3.0

7,371

major competitor apps

place691005778

37,575 competing apps

Median installs: 32,284

Avg rating: 2.9

4,364

major competitor apps

graphical701003755

1,697 competing apps

Median installs: 26,769

Avg rating: 2.7

132

major competitor apps

learn671006182

64,313 competing apps

Median installs: 33,093

Avg rating: 2.8

6,746

major competitor apps

designed661005785

96,808 competing apps

Median installs: 27,484

Avg rating: 2.8

9,110

major competitor apps

108 keywords
1 of 5

App Description

Learn Python 3 with the most powerful Python 3 interpreter & IDE on Google Play

Pydroid 3 is the most easy to use and powerful educational Python 3 IDE for Android.

Features:
- Offline Python 3 interpreter: no Internet is required to run Python programs.
- Pip package manager and a custom repository for prebuilt wheel packages for enhanced scientific libraries, such as numpy, scipy, matplotlib, scikit-learn and jupyter.
- OpenCV is now available (on devices with Camera2 API support). *
- TensorFlow and PyTorch are also available. *
- Examples available out-of-the-box for quicker learning.
- Complete Tkinter support for GUI.
- Full-featured Terminal Emulator, with a readline support (available in pip).
- Built-in C, C++ and even Fortran compiler designed specially for Pydroid 3. It lets Pydroid 3 build any library from pip, even if it is using native code. You can also build & install dependencies from a command line.
- Cython support.
- PDB debugger with breakpoints and watches.
- Kivy graphical library with a shiny new SDL2 backend.
- PySide6 support available in Quick Install repository along with matplotlib PySide6 support with no extra code required.
- Matplotlib Kivy support available in Quick Install repository.
- pygame 2 support.

Editor features:
- Code prediction, auto indentation and real time code analysis just like in any real IDE. *
- Extended keyboard bar with all symbols you need to program in Python.
- Syntax highlighting & themes.
- Tabs.
- Enhanced code navigation with interactive assignment/definition gotos.
- One click share on Pastebin.

* Features marked by asterisk are available in Premium version only.

Quick manual.
Pydroid 3 requires at least 250MB free internal memory. 300MB+ is recommended. More if you are using heavy libraries such as scipy.
To run debug place breakpoint(s) clicking on the line number.
Kivy is detected with “import kivy”, “from kivy“ or "#Pydroid run kivy”.
PySide6 is detected with “import PySide6”, “from PySide6“ or "#Pydroid run qt”.
The same for sdl2, tkinter and pygame.
There is a special mode "#Pydroid run terminal" to ensure your program runs in terminal mode (this is useful with matplotlib that automatically runs in GUI mode)

Why are some libraries premium-only?
These libraries were extremely hard to port, so we had to ask another developer to do that. Under agreement, his forks of these libraries are provided to the premium